Biography

Jaebok Lee is an associate in White & Case’s International Trade Practice. His practice focuses on economic sanctions, export controls, and international trade remedies. Jaebok advises sovereigns and companies operating in the technology, financial services, semiconductor, manufacturing, and other sectors in navigating complex and cross-border issues arising from US trade and national security regulations.

Jaebok is a graduate of Harvard Law School, where he was the President of the Harvard Asia Law Society and served on the Editorial Board of the Harvard International Law Journal. Prior to law school, Jaebok served as a Sergeant in the Republic of Korea Army’s Judge Advocate General’s Corps. He received his B.S. in Foreign Service from Georgetown University.
